High-ROI Green Upgrades Guests Notice
LED Lighting & Smart Switches
LED bulbs use up to 75% less energy than incandescents and last 25 times longer. Swapping every bulb in your rental to LED is a low-cost, high-impact upgrade that pays for itself in utility savings within months. Pair LEDs with smart switches or motion sensors (e.g., Lutron Maestro, TP-Link Kasa) to ensure lights aren’t left on when the property is vacant.
ROI Example: A 3-bedroom Airbnb switching to all-LED lighting and installing smart switches can cut lighting electricity costs by up to 60%, saving $150–$300 per year, with a payback period of less than one peak season.
Low-Flow Fixtures Guests Appreciate
Low-flow showerheads and faucets reduce water usage by up to 32% without sacrificing pressure or comfort. Modern models (like Niagara Conservation or Moen) are designed for a satisfying shower experience, which is crucial for positive guest reviews.
ROI Example: A property with four guests using low-flow fixtures can save 10,000+ gallons of water annually, reducing water bills by $100–$200 per year. The investment typically pays back within two busy seasons.
Water Refill Stations & Filtered Water
Single-use plastic is a major guest turnoff. Install a filtered water station (such as a Brita dispenser or Berkey filter) and provide reusable bottles. This not only reduces waste but also earns positive mentions in reviews.
Tip: Place a countertop sign inviting guests to refill bottles and highlighting your commitment to reducing plastic waste.
Clear Recycling & Composting Systems
Guests want to recycle, but only if it’s easy and obvious. Provide clearly labeled bins for recycling, compost, and landfill waste. Use visual signage (icons, color coding) and a simple guide showing what goes where. Suppliers like Simplehuman offer stylish, dual-compartment bins that fit any decor.
Pro Tip: Add a laminated “Recycling Quick Guide” near the kitchen and link to your local recycling rules (Earth911 is a great resource).

EV Charging Stations
With electric vehicle adoption surging, EV chargers are one of the fastest-growing high-ROI amenities. Install a Level 2 charger (e.g., Tesla Wall Connector, ChargePoint) to attract eco-conscious travelers and command a premium nightly rate.
ROI Example: Properties with EV chargers can increase value by up to 15% and recoup installation costs within 9–12 months through higher rates and charging fees.
Guest-Friendly Copy & Signage: Avoiding Greenwashing
Writing Authentic, Impactful Green Messaging
Guests are savvy—they can spot greenwashing a mile away. Use clear, honest language that highlights real actions and measurable results. Avoid vague claims like “eco-friendly” unless you specify how.
Best Practices:
- Be specific: “All lighting is LED and 100% powered by renewable energy.”
- Quantify impact: “Our low-flow fixtures save 12,000 gallons of water per year.”
- Invite participation: “Help us reduce waste by using the refill station and recycling bins.”
Example Copy for Listing Description:
“Enjoy a comfortable stay in a home designed for sustainability—LED lighting, filtered water refill station, and easy recycling make it simple to travel green. Your stay helps us save over 10,000 gallons of water and 1,000 kWh of energy each year.”
Effective In-Home Signage
- Use laminated cards or framed signs for key eco features.
- Keep instructions simple and visual (icons, color codes).
- Place signs where action happens: above recycling bins, by the water filter, near light switches.
Avoid: Overloading guests with rules or guilt trips. Focus on empowerment and ease.

Measuring Savings and Impact: Proving ROI
Tracking Utility Savings
- Electricity: Compare monthly bills before and after upgrades. Use smart meters or apps like Sense for granular tracking.
- Water: Monitor usage via utility statements or install a smart water monitor (Flume).
- Waste: Track trash/recycling volumes and frequency of pickups.
Calculating ROI
Use this formula:
[
\text{Annual ROI} = \frac{\text{(Increased Annual Revenue – Annual Upgrade Costs)}}{\text{Total Upgrade Investment}}
]
- Factor in higher nightly rates, increased occupancy, and utility savings.
- Most high-impact green upgrades pay for themselves in 6–18 months.

Advanced Strategies: Going Beyond the Basics
Solar Panels & Renewable Energy
If your property is in a sunny region, solar panels can increase resale value by 4–5% and pay for themselves in under eight years. Some platforms, like Sustonica, offer sustainability badges for STRs powered by renewables, boosting your search rank and justifying a rate premium.
Upcycled & Recycled Materials
Properties built or furnished with upcycled materials (reclaimed wood, recycled glass, etc.) are trending, with Airbnb reporting a 175% increase in such listings over four years. Highlight these features in your listing and photos for extra guest appeal.
EV Charging as a Revenue Stream
Charge guests a nightly or per-use fee for EV charging. Use smart chargers that track usage and automate billing (ChargePoint offers host solutions).
